Output 7bd6afda47698185f7405496a5ba3bae379c1c073c9cccdd5f71a114dbee8837:1

value
52683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f900661555b186677e8e081900526218846e14 OP_EQUAL
address
3MZYr6u2ArKPV4KeiKzHsT31sNfjAxrHXZ
transaction
7bd6afda47698185f7405496a5ba3bae379c1c073c9cccdd5f71a114dbee8837
confirmations
300301
spent
true